Indigenous to North America, Circaea alpina subsp. pacifica (commonly known as Pacific enchanter's nightshade or Small Enchanter's Nightshade) is a herbaceous perennial belonging to the Onagraceae family. Within its native range, this subspecies is primarily associated with temperate conditions. It is a naturally occurring subspecies of Circaea alpina, which is linked below, along with other subspecies of this species.
